Maria Belen Simari Birkner


María Belén Simari Birkner (18 August 1982) is a female skier from Argentina. She has represented Argentina in both the 2006 and the 2010 Winter Olympics, in the Alpine skiing events. She also took part in the 2005 Alpine Skiing World Cup, where she came 20th in the Women's Combined, and in the FIS Alpine World Ski Championships 2009. She is the sister of fellow alpine skiers Cristian Simari Birkner and Macarena Simari Birkner.

Results

2005 Alpine Skiing World Cup:
Combined– 28
2006 Winter Olympics:
Giant Slalom–DNF
Slalom–37
Super-G–47
Combined–29
FIS Alpine World Ski Championships 2007:
Super Combined–27
Giant Slalom–46
Slalom–DNF
2010 Winter Olympics:
Downhill– 29
Slalom– DNF
Giant Slalom– 46
Super-G– 31
Combined– DNF
